| 1 | +# Module Evaluation Questionnaires (MEQ) |
| 2 | + |
| 3 | +## Information for students |
| 4 | + |
| 5 | +Students can provide feedback to teachers to recognise good practice and help improve teaching. |
| 6 | + |
| 7 | +Each module can contain one or more Module Evaluation Questionnaire (MEQ), which appears in the content as a separate type of Set. When accessed, the MEQ is seen in the context of all open MEQs at the time (across all modules). |
| 8 | + |
| 9 | +Student responses are treated as follows: |
| 10 | + |
| 11 | +- Responses are saved when 'SUBMIT' is pressed, with confirmation provided. |
| 12 | +- Multiple responses are possible. Responses are initialised by the last saved submission, and can then be edited and re-submitted with the 'SUBMIT' button. |
| 13 | +- Only the last response is used when displaying data to teachers. |
| 14 | +- All responses are confidential to all users of the platform, i.e. the author of the response is never associated with the response when it is displayed to teachers. |
| 15 | +- No responses are visible to teachers while an MEQ is open. |
| 16 | + |
| 17 | + |
| 18 | +### Access to MEQ data |
| 19 | + |
| 20 | +MEQ data are only accessible to teachers, and only under certain conditions. A minimum of 5 responses are required, after which data is accessible to teachers depending on question type and user role. Note that the 'moderator' is assigned per-module by central admin, and it is typically the director of studies. Data availability is as follows: |

| 22 | +#### Numerical data (Likert scale): |
| 23 | + |
| 24 | +|MEQ is open | Response is about a specific teacher? | Available to | |
| 25 | +|--|--|--| |
| 26 | +|Yes |n/a|Data not available| |
| 27 | +|No |No|Any teacher or moderator on the module| |
| 28 | +|No |Yes|Only that teacher and the moderator| |
| 29 | + |
| 30 | + |
| 31 | +#### Text data (comments): |
| 32 | + |
| 33 | +|MEQ is open | Response is about a specific teacher? | Moderator approved? |Available to | |
| 34 | +|--|--|--|--| |
| 35 | +|Yes |n/a| n/a |Moderator (only)| |
| 36 | +|No |No| No |Moderator (only)| |
| 37 | +|No |No| Yes |Any teacher on the module| |
| 38 | +|No |Yes| No |Moderator (only)| |
| 39 | +|No |Yes| Yes |Only that teacher and the moderator| |

| 41 | +### Progress bar |
| 42 | + |
| 43 | +When a student has open MEQs that are incomplete, a progress bar will appear on the home page. When all MEQs are complete, or none is open, the bar will disappear. |
